10. Auto Balancers
More Downforce For The Speedster

- User: Tenya Ida
- Creator: Mei Hatsume
- First Appearance: Episode 21
In her quest to become a hero, Ida struggles with mastering his unique ability, which becomes particularly challenging when moving at high speeds. At a certain point, he loses balance and usually ends up crashing. To help Ida navigate these difficulties until his body adjusts, Mei Hatsume from U.A.’s Development Studio designed the Auto Balancing Devices.
The aid for Ida comprises two elements. One is knee supports designed to facilitate smooth leg movement for him. The second part is a small, functional wing attached to his back, serving as a balance aid and enhancing the adhesion to the ground – similar to a racing car’s spoiler. This assistance allows Ida to fully exploit his Quirk’s capabilities, significantly boosting his heroic abilities in return.
9. Artificial Vocal Cords
A Voice Changer For The Brainwasher

- User: Hitoshi Shinso
- Creator: U.A.’s Development Studio
- First Appearance: Episode 91
Hitoshi Shinso possesses a unique ability where he can manipulate minds through speech. However, the major drawback of this talent is that once someone has been subjected to Shinso’s mind control and understands its mechanism, they will no longer be affected by his voice, making his power ineffective against them.
To overcome this restriction, the UA’s Development Studio fashioned what is known as the Artificial Vocal Cords. This auxiliary device empowers Shinso with the ability to alter his voice, imitating others. As a result, it becomes more challenging for his target to ignore responding to his altered voice.
8. Sharpshooting Gear
A Device To Control And Channel Electricity

- User: Denki Kaminari
- Creator: Mei Hatsume and Power Loader
- First Appearance: Episode 56
As an onlooker, I must admit that Denki Kaminari’s Quirk stands out among his peers. His electricity, after all, proves effective against a singular adversary or a group. It’s not just limited to close-quarters fighting; it can be employed for mid-range and even long-distance combat as well.
Regrettably, Kaminari has no mastery over his power, only able to activate and deactivate it. The introduction of Mei Hatsume’s invention, the Sharpshooting Equipment, has provided him with a means to control the flow of his electricity. With this device, he can now direct and adjust the strength of his electric discharge towards a specific target. Thanks to the Sharpshooting Equipment, Kaminari’s electrical charge is no longer an uncontrolled blast.
7. Strafe Panzer
Retractable Machine Guns With Explosive Bullets

- User: Katsuki Bakugo
- Creator: Unknown Support Company
- First Appearance: Episode 148
Despite already possessing the distinctive Grenadier Bracers, which store and discharge nitroglycerin-like sweat in massive blasts, it’s evident that Bakugo yearns for even greater power. His insatiable desire isn’t just for more explosions, but for something that could amplify their reach, allowing him to spread his destructive force across a broad expanse.
In response to Bakugo’s distinctive demand, the maker of his Grenadier Bracers presented him with the Strafe Panzer – essentially a large, retractable gun mounted on his back that can discharge his explosive perspiration as rapid-fire bullets, effectively covering a broad area. In essence, it’s similar to the machine guns used by the Warmachine character in the Iron Man films, but tailored for Bakugo. This additional piece of equipment significantly boosts the adaptability of Bakugo’s Quirk.

4. Full Gauntlet
A Protective Pair Of Gauntlets

- User: Izuku Midoriya
- Creator: Melissa Shield
- First Appearance: My Hero Academia: Two Heroes
One major struggle for Deku is that he can’t fully unleash the destructive potential of One For All without causing harm to his own body. As a result, he’s limited to using just a fraction of his power. However, everything shifted when Melissa Shield handed him the Full Gauntlet.
According to its title, the Full Gauntlet is a set of arm protectors that tightly encircle Deku’s arms. These protective gear absorb all the destructive energy from One For All that would normally affect his arms. This enables Deku to utilize his immense power without fearing harm to his arms. In essence, the Full Gauntlet allows him to release 100% of his incredible destructive force up to three times before needing a replacement pair.

2. Armored All Might
The MHA Version Of An Iron Man Suit

- User: Toshinori Yagi
- Creator: Melissa Shield
- First Appearance: Episode 159
If David Shield owns an enhanced Batmobile, then All Might possesses a strengthened Iron Man suit. Before the impending war, All Might anticipated that he might have to confront All For One. As he can no longer use his power, he asks Melissa Shield to create a powerful combat armor for him. That’s how the Armored All Might was made.
This armor not just boasts extraordinary durability and boosts strength, speed, and flight abilities, but it’s also equipped with weapons inspired by the unique powers (Quirks) of Class 1-A students. From the invincible shield of Red Riot to Deku’s restraining Blackwhip to the blinding light of Shining Hero, this armor effectively mimics the Quirks of All Might’s cherished disciples.
1. Deku’s Armor
An Improved Version Of All Might’s Armor

- User: Izuku Midoriya
- Creator: Mei Hatsume and Melissa Shield
- First Appearance: Chapter 430
In contrast to All Might being the sole quirkless hero to wear armored gear, there’s another young hero who receives an upgraded version of it. After Deku lost his Quirk in battle against Shigaraki, All Might later gifts this new hero with a revamped Armored All Might suit. This modernized power armor was developed through a joint effort between American and Japanese scientists, under the guidance of Melissa Shield and Mei Hatsume, and financed by Deku’s classmates.
In an updated form, Deku’s Armor stands as a lighter and highly flexible counterpart to All Might’s original armor, tailored to suit Deku’s combat techniques. Just like its predecessor, the latest version of the armor incorporates technology inspired by actual Quirks. However, unlike before, the replicated abilities stem from Deku’s One For All power. This new armor boasts capabilities such as floating, danger sensing, creating smokescreens, and utilizing Fa Jin – making it a versatile tool for Deku in battle.
